Sr Quality Assurance Engineer
The Sr. Quality Assurance Engineer is responsible for quality planning and the implementation of the Hydra 70 program quality requirements at key suppliers within the Armament Strategic Business Unit (SBU). The job is centered in the Philadelphia, PA area; however frequent travel will be required to support local and remote suppliers. The primary job responsibilities include developing test plans and reports, conducting regular Technical Data Package (TDP) compliance and process audits, ensuring that all contractual and quality system requirements are understood and flowed to the suppliers, reviewing and maintaining procedures, developing variation reduction plans, and the resolution of internal and external quality issues. The position is also responsible for monitoring and reporting supplier quality performance and initiating preventive and corrective action, as required. The role requires frequent interface with suppliers, manufacturing operations, customers and the Defense Contract Management Agency (DCMA).
The individual must be a self starter, able to work independently and with minimal direction. An ability to interface with multiple functions at various levels will be required. Key skills will include the ability to influence through effective communication, both written and verbal. The individual must possess excellent facilitation and problem solving skills. An ability to act in a professional manner and demonstrate ethical behavior is required.
Requirements:
Bachelor's Degree in a technical discipline.
4-5 years work experience. Prefer experience in quality engineering, DoD/Aerospace environment, ISO/AS 9000 Quality System Standards, internal/supplier auditing, material review board (MRB) activities, and failure analysis/problem solving abilities.

Description:
General Dynamics Armament and Technical Products is a proven solutions integrator of defense systems for all branches of the U.S. Department of Defense (DoD). Our Armament Systems business unit develops, integrates, manufacture and supports market leading armament and survivability systems for ground, sea and aircraft applications for the armed forces of the United States and allied nations.
A recognized industry leader in quality performance, the Office of Naval Research's Best Manufacturing Practices Program identified 19 GDATP company business practices as "Best Practices" industry-wide. GDATP is ISO 9001:2000 registered, and GDATP continues to received many prestigious aerospace supplier, DoD, and industry and environmental awards.
